black damp

noun

Definition of BLACK DAMP

:  a carbon dioxide mixture occurring as a mine gas and incapable of supporting life or flame

black damp

noun

Medical Definition of BLACK DAMP

:  a nonexplosive mine gas that is a mixture containing carbon dioxide and is incapable of supporting life or flame—compare firedamp
